The volume of a cube depends on the length of its sides. This can be written in function notation as v(s). What is the best inte

rpretation of v(2) = 8?
A. A cube with a volume of 2 cubic feet has side lengths of 8 feet.
B. 2 of these cubes will have a total volume of 8 cubic feet.
C. 2 sides of the cube have a total length of 8 feet.
D. A cube with side lengths of 2 feet has a volume of 8 cubic feet.

Let

s--------> the length side of the cube

we know that

the volume of the cube is equal to

V(s)= s^{3}

if the length side s is equal to 2\ feet

then

s=2\ feet

and the volume is equal to

V(2)= 2^{3}

V(2)= 8\ feet^{3}

therefore

<u>the answer is the option</u>

D. A cube with side lengths of 2 feet has a volume of 8 cubic feet.
